2. Mega Charger Infrastructure Challenges

Unlike passenger EVs, electric trucks require 750 kWh mega chargers, each costing up to $6 million to install. These chargers demand:

  • Utility company coordination
  • Local government approvals
  • Grid upgrades
  • Long construction timelines

Even PepsiCo, one of Tesla’s biggest Semi customers, has spent nearly two years building just four mega chargers at its Sacramento facility.

This infrastructure bottleneck has slowed mass deployment more than the truck itself.

Hand-Built Precision

Unlike Tesla’s passenger vehicles, the Semi does not benefit from Gigapress automation. Instead:

  • 70–80% of the truck is hand-assembled
  • Built by highly skilled engineers
  • Remaining automation is still being optimized

Currently, only around 300 Tesla Semis exist worldwide, including 36 operated by PepsiCo. That number is expected to rise sharply once Gen 2 enters full production.

Tesla Semi Pricing: From Shock to Strategy

When unveiled in 2017, Tesla promised:

  • $150,000 for 300-mile range
  • $180,000 for 500-mile range
  • $200,000 for Founders Series

Today, reality looks very different.

Updated Price Estimates

Industry analysts now estimate:

  • $300,000 to $415,000 for the 500-mile version
  • A price increase of 67% to 131%

Ryder, a major logistics partner, reduced its Semi order from 42 trucks to 18, citing changes in Tesla’s product economics.

Gigafactory Nevada Expansion

Tesla is investing $3.6 billion to expand Gigafactory Nevada, adding:

  • 4 million square feet
  • One facility for Semi production
  • One facility for 4680 battery manufacturing

Tesla plans to produce:

  • 5 GWh per year per production line
  • Eight lines operational by year-end

Once Cybertruck 4680 production stabilizes, surplus cells will be redirected to the Semi.
